#bba764 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bba764 is composed of 73.3% red, 65.5%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.7% magenta, 46.5%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 46.2 degrees, a saturation of 39% and a lightness of 56.3%. #bba764 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c8 with #774f00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#bba764

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090704 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#bba764

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#90908f is the less saturated color, while #f7c728 is the most saturated one.
